首页 要闻简讯 > 网络互联问答中心 > 正文

vlookup函数匹配错误

当你在使用Excel中的VLOOKUP函数进行匹配时遇到错误,可能是由以下几个原因导致的:

1. 语法错误:确保你正确地使用了VLOOKUP的语法。基本语法为:`VLOOKUP(查找值, 查找范围, 返回值所在的列号, 近似匹配或精确匹配)`。

2. 查找范围问题:确保你的查找范围是正确的,并且第一列包含你要查找的值。VLOOKUP默认是从查找范围的第一列开始搜索的。

3. 近似匹配与精确匹配:如果你选择了近似匹配(或未指定),但你的数据是精确的,可能会导致错误的结果。确保你选择了正确的匹配类型。

4. 数据格式问题:确保你要查找的值和查找范围中的值的数据格式是相同的。例如,一个文本值和一个数字值是不匹配的,除非它们是相同的格式。

5. 空值或隐藏值问题:有时,数据区域可能包含空值或隐藏的非打印字符,这可能会影响VLOOKUP的结果。

6. 动态数组与VLOOKUP的结合使用:如果你尝试在一个包含多个结果的动态数组中结合使用VLOOKUP,可能会遇到问题。在某些版本的Excel中,可能需要使用其他方法,如FILTER或INDEX与MATCH组合来实现这一目的。

7. 数据排序问题:在使用精确匹配时,查找的数据范围中的列必须按升序排序,否则VLOOKUP可能无法找到正确的值。如果你没有按照正确的顺序排序数据,你可能需要使用其他方法或重新排序数据。

解决上述问题后,你的VLOOKUP函数应该能够正常工作。如果仍然遇到问题,请提供更多详细信息或具体的例子,我会尽量帮助你解决。

免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。